Transaction 613236e68d80f23e813cb88a84bffb80d8089fc37a20abd9979c40f01e697fc0

2 Input
1 Outputs
  • 613236e68d80f23e813cb88a84bffb80d8089fc37a20abd9979c40f01e697fc0:0
  • value  4809787
    address  12C39DxeDbWpefSDoQhX5Wn9fc61qH2HnS